FLUIDAIR POWER Scunthorpe Scorpions, supported by Henderson Insurance, are involved in a must-win Premier League encounter with the Plymouth Devils at the Eddie Wright Raceway tonight (Friday, 7.30pm).

The Devils are the team directly above the Scorpions in the league table. Scunthorpe, despite all the bad luck that has hit them this season, are determined not to finish bottom of the Premier League.

Thomas Jorgensen (pictured), such an impressive guest for Scunthorpe two weeks ago against Peterborough, will cover for injured Scorpions’ No 1 Josh Auty, while Benji Compton comes in at No 7 for Nike Lunna, who is riding in the Finnish Under-21 Championship.

Lunna’s fellow reserve, Ben Wilson, crashed out of last night’s (Thursday) Sheffield vs Cradley meeting, and it seems highly likely a guest replacement will be required. Confirmation will follow later today.

Scunthorpe promoter Rob Godfrey says: “We need a win tonight, because Plymouth are one of the teams we’d like to overhaul in the league table.

“I think we’re in for some great entertainment, and the racing promises to be top notch, as usual. The clashes between our lads and Plymouth’s No 1 Ryan Fisher should be something special.

“Thomas Jorgensen was brilliant as a guest here two weeks ago, and we’re looking for big performances from our top five tonight.

“After last week’s meeting that was packed full of incident, I wonder what will happen next at the Eddie Wright Raceway? The only way to find out is to be here.”
